GTE, known chemically by its CAS number 13236-02-7, is a trifunctional epoxide monomer. Its unique molecular structure, featuring three reactive epoxy groups, allows it to act as both a reactive diluent and a powerful crosslinking agent. This dual capability makes it invaluable for formulators aiming to improve the characteristics of their epoxy systems.
One of the primary benefits of incorporating GTE into epoxy formulations is its ability to significantly reduce viscosity. For procurement managers and R&D scientists, this translates to easier handling, improved processing, and better wettability of pigments and fillers. This not only streamlines production but also leads to more uniform and high-quality final products. The low volatility of GTE further enhances its appeal, contributing to a safer working environment.
Beyond viscosity modification, GTE dramatically enhances the mechanical properties of cured epoxy resins. When used in typical concentrations of 5%-20%, it contributes to remarkable improvements in tensile strength, flexural strength, compressive strength, and impact strength. This makes GTE an essential ingredient for applications demanding high durability and resilience, such as in industrial coatings, structural adhesives, and robust composite materials.

Furthermore, GTE's applications extend beyond traditional epoxy systems. It also functions effectively as a crosslinking agent for polyurethane emulsions and is utilized in fiber wrinkle treatment, electronic sealing, and building adhesives. This versatility underscores its importance as a foundational chemical intermediate in various industrial sectors.
